Accident analysis of the Beijing lithium battery explosion

On April 16 an explosion occurred when Beijing firefighters were responding to a fire in a 25 MWh lithium-iron phosphate battery connected to a rooftop solar panel installation. Ukraine''s First Industrial Lithium-ion Energy

On May 21st, DTEK has officially launched Ukraine''s first industrial lithium-ion energy storage system, installed at the Zaporizhzhya Power Plant in the city of Energodar, with a capacity of 1 MW/2.25 MWh. The battery will store and
